LPL Financial LLC Has $3.69 Million Stock Position in Capital Southwest Co. (NASDAQ:CSWC)

Capital Southwest logo with Finance background

LPL Financial LLC decreased its position in Capital Southwest Co. (NASDAQ:CSWC - Free Report) by 11.9%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 169,054 shares of the asset manager's stock after selling 22,942 shares during the quarter. LPL Financial LLC owned about 0.33% of Capital Southwest worth $3,689,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

A number of other hedge funds have also recently added to or reduced their stakes in CSWC. Samalin Investment Counsel LLC lifted its stake in shares of Capital Southwest by 10.9% in the 4th quarter. Samalin Investment Counsel LLC now owns 22,704 shares of the asset manager's stock valued at $495,000 after purchasing an additional 2,228 shares during the last quarter. Quantbot Technologies LP lifted its holdings in Capital Southwest by 190.1% in the 4th quarter. Quantbot Technologies LP now owns 36,631 shares of the asset manager's stock worth $799,000 after purchasing an additional 24,006 shares during the last quarter. Corient Private Wealth LLC grew its holdings in Capital Southwest by 49.6% during the fourth quarter. Corient Private Wealth LLC now owns 16,581 shares of the asset manager's stock valued at $362,000 after purchasing an additional 5,494 shares during the last quarter. Naviter Wealth LLC bought a new position in shares of Capital Southwest in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$1,823,000. Finally, Rialto Wealth Management LLC bought a new stake in shares of Capital Southwest during the 4th quarter worth $105,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 23.42% of the company's stock.

Capital Southwest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:CSWC traded down $0.13 on Wednesday, hitting $19.63. 37,002 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 412,616. The firm has a market capitalization of $992.67 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 13.92 and a beta of 0.99.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.64, a quick ratio of 0.18 and a current ratio of 0.18. Capital Southwest Co. has a one year low of $17.46 and a one year high of $27.23. The company's 50 day moving average price is $22.00 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$22.77.

Capital Southwest (NASDAQ:CSWC -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Monday, February 3rd. The asset manager reported $0.63 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.62 by $0.01. Capital Southwest had a net margin of 33.49% and a return on equity of 15.18%. Research analysts expect that Capital Southwest Co. will post 2.54 earnings per share for the current year.

Capital Southwest Cuts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 31st.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 14th were given a dividend of $0.58 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, March 14th. This represents a $2.32 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 11.82%. Capital Southwest's payout ratio is currently 164.54%.

Capital Southwest Profile

(Free Report)

Capital Southwest Corporation is a business development company specializing in credit and private equity and venture capital investments in middle market companies, mezzanine, later stage, mature, late venture, emerging growth, buyouts, industry consolidation, recapitalizations and growth capital investments.
